Nestled at the base of the Great Rift Valley escarpment in northern Tanzania, Lake Manyara National Park is a scenic haven known for its varied ecosystems and abundant wildlife. Although smaller in size compared to other parks, its biodiversity is astonishing—ranging from lush groundwater forests to acacia woodlands and the alkaline lake itself.
Often described as “Africa’s most underrated safari park,” Lake Manyara offers a perfect introduction to Tanzania’s wilderness, especially for those combining multiple safari destinations.
Why Visit Lake Manyara National Park
1. Famous Tree-Climbing Lions
Lake Manyara is one of the few places in Africa where lions are known to regularly climb trees—a rare and fascinating sight for wildlife enthusiasts and photographers.
2. Spectacular Birdlife
The alkaline waters of Lake Manyara attract thousands of flamingos and over 400 other bird species, making the park a birdwatcher’s paradise.
3. Scenic Beauty and Ecological Diversity
The park’s contrasting landscapes—ranging from dense jungle and open plains to the dramatic Rift Valley escarpment—make every game drive visually rewarding and ecologically diverse.
4. Elephant Encounters
Large elephant herds roam the park freely, often seen in the forested areas near the lake. It’s a great destination for close elephant sightings in a peaceful setting.
5. Hippos and Aquatic Life
Hippos are commonly seen wallowing in pools or lounging near the lake shore, while monkeys, baboons, and antelope frequent the forested trails.
6. Canoeing and Nature Walks (Seasonal)
Depending on water levels, Lake Manyara offers unique canoe safaris for a closer view of aquatic life. Guided walking safaris also allow visitors to explore on foot with experienced rangers.
7. Ideal for Short Safaris and Day Trips
Due to its proximity to Arusha and compact size, Lake Manyara is perfect for a day trip or as the first stop on a longer northern circuit safari.
8. Nearby Attractions
Located en route to Ngorongoro Crater and Serengeti, Lake Manyara fits seamlessly into a larger safari itinerary through northern Tanzania.
